Introduction to E&M
Note: There are alternative explanations for the term "E&M". "E" can stand for "Ear" or "recEive" and "M" can
stand for "Mouth"or "transMit".
Dial initiation The E&M interface does not support dial tones. Therefore, the dial
supervisory signaling initiation supervisory signaling is used to start dialing.
Note: Although the E&M interface's audio channel consists of a maximum of four wires, an interface may
have 6 to 8 physical wires including the signaling control buses.
